Top Of The Rock Overview

Top of the Rock is a renowned observation deck situated at 30 Rockefeller Plaza in New York City. It has become a must-visit location for tourists and locals alike, known for its spectacular views of the Manhattan skyline. Whether you are visiting for the first time or are a frequent guest, this popular destination offers an unforgettable experience that captures the heart of NYC.

The observation deck is situated on the 70th floor and features three distinct levels that provide breathtaking panoramic views. From its vantage point, visitors can admire iconic landmarks, including the Empire State Building, Central Park, and the Hudson River. The unique layout of these observation areas allows guests to appreciate the splendor of the city in every direction.

The Top of the Rock observation deck has a rich history. It was part of the original Rockefeller Center development that began in the 1930s. After the deck’s completion in 1933, it quickly became famous for its remarkable sights. How to Get to Top Of The Rock

Getting to Top of the Rock is easy, thanks to its central location within Manhattan. The address is 30 Rockefeller Plaza, New York City, NY 10111. If you’re using public transportation, the subway is a convenient option. The nearest subway stations are located at 47th-50th Streets-Rockefeller Center, served by the B, D, F, and M lines, and the 49th Street station on the N and Q lines.

Radio City Music Hall

This world-famous entertainment venue, known for its annual Christmas Spectacular featuring the Rockettes, is an iconic location worth visiting. The beautifully restored Art Deco theatre offers backstage tours and hosts various performances, making it a must-see when in the Rockefeller Center area.
